Sr Incident Responder Job Type: Full-time, Contract Contract Duration: 6 Months (Renewable) Location: Remote (US-based) Industry: Telecommunications Start Date: ASAP Job Summary: We're working with a global enterprise seeking a Senior Incident Responder to join their Cyber Incident Response Team (CIRT). This role plays a critical part in responding to and containing security incidents, performing deep technical analysis, and strengthening incident response capabilities across the business. You'll be joining a mature, well-resourced cyber function, collaborating with Threat Intel, SOC, and Engineering teams to detect, analyze, and respond to advanced threats in real time. Key Responsibilities: • Lead investigations of complex cyber incidents involving malware, phishing, lateral movement, and potential data exfiltration • Conduct forensic analysis on endpoints, servers, and network traffic using EDR and log analysis tools • Work closely with SOC analysts and Threat Hunters to validate, triage, and contain threats • Develop and refine incident response playbooks, escalation processes, and threat detection rules • Coordinate response efforts across internal teams and third-party stakeholders • Deliver post-incident reports including root cause, lessons learned, and remediation recommendations • Contribute to red/purple teaming efforts and tabletop exercises • Provide mentoring and technical guidance to junior team members What We're Looking For • 5-8+ years in cybersecurity with significant experience in incident response and digital forensics • Strong knowledge of Windows/Linux systems, network protocols, and attack techniques (MITRE ATT&CK) • Experience using tools such as CrowdStrike, EnCase, Splunk, Wireshark, Volatility Velociraptor, etc. • Familiarity with scripting or automation (Python, PowerShell, or Bash) • Excellent written and verbal communication - ability to produce high-quality incident reports • Strong understanding of regulatory/compliance-driven environments (PCI, HIPAA, SOX, etc.) GCS is acting as an Employment Business in relation to this vacancy.
